This national IFA firm, with a highly client centric approach to financial planning is currently seeking a financial planning administrator to work as part of their team in their office near Penrith.

In this role you will undertake tasks including:

  • Inputting new business applications and following these cases through to completion
  • Processing investment and pension withdrawals
  • Providing technical support both internally and externally with clients
  • Compliance monitoring
  • Assisting in the production of suitability reports
  • Project work when required

This firm offers an inhouse training academy, and excellent long-term opportunities to progress your career within the firm.

You must have experience working in a financial planning administrator role and ideally have experience of IO / platforms and an understanding of model portfolios and DFM's alongside excellent communication and team working skills.

Basic salary to £30,000 benefits.
